Sep 03, 2019 My experience of bending 15mm pipe is to put a pipe-bending spring into a pipe that has to be approx 1m long so that it can be bent round a knee. This relatively long length is needed to be able to apply enough force to bend the pipe. Then the bit with the bend in it can be cut out and used.
Jun 18, 2021 Slide the copper tube into the pipe bender. Insert one end of the tube into the open slot between the two handles. Make sure the tube is perfectly aligned with the groove in the rounded bender die. Feed the tube into the pipe bender until the section you marked is resting over the bender die.

Sep 02, 2021 Use a bending spring to bend copper pipes by hand. Purchase a bending spring that matches the diameter of the pipe and stuff it inside of the pipe you want to bend. Then, bend the pipe slowly by hand. The bending spring will keep the pipe from kinking as you bend it. You may need to bend the pipe around the front of your knee to get a little ...

Copper tube bending OK, let’s get cracking with copper tube, here’s a reminder of the different types of copper: The type of copper tube suitable for bending is BS EN 1057 - R250 (previously designated as BS EN 1057; Part 1 - Table X). It’s termed as half hard, and is available in straight lengths.

Bending copper pipe Using a spring Internal spring. Before you start, tie a length of cord to the eye on the end of the spring, this will allow the spring to be removed from the pipe. Insert the spring into the pipe so that it is positioned evenly across the area of the required bend. If the spring is a tight fit in the pipe, rotate the spring ...

Prepare the microbore pipe tail for soldering checking that it is clean all the way round. Solder to the fitting reducer (making sure the valve nut is over the pipe first!). DON'T solder the joint with the valve attached as this is likely to damage rubber and plastic parts inside the valve. Check that solder can be seen all around the joint.

Copper tubing is most often used for heating systems and as a refrigerant line in HVAC systems. Copper tubing is slowly being replaced by PEX tubing in hot and cold water applications. There are two basic types of copper tubing, soft copper and rigid copper. Copper tubing is joined using flare connection, compression connection, pressed connection, or solder.
